952,900 is a composite number, even.
952,900 (nine hundred fifty-two thousand nine hundred) is an even 6-digit number. It is a composite number with 36 divisors, and factors as 2² × 5² × 13 × 733. Its proper divisors sum to 1,276,992,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xE8A44.
